簡單的排序方法

迷人如愛發表於2020-08-21
    function customSort($arr){
        if (count($arr) < 2){
            return $arr;
        }else{
            $min = $arr[0];
            $small = [];
            $big = [];
            foreach($arr as $k=>$value){
                if ($k=0){
                    continue;
                }
                if ($value>$min){
                    $big[] = $value;
                }
                if ($value<$min){
                    $small[] = $value;
                }
            }
        }
        return array_merge(customSort($small),[$min],customSort($big));
    }
本作品採用《CC 協議》,轉載必須註明作者和本文連結

相關文章